加密网站 为什么前端代码会被设计成允许用户在浏览器中看到,而客户端代码却不能?
浏览量:1248
时间:2021-03-21 12:07:48
作者:admin
为什么前端代码会被设计成允许用户在浏览器中看到,而客户端代码却不能?
前端不愿意故意向客户机显示代码,而是出于技术原因。前端通过客户端浏览器解析HTML、JS和CSS来呈现界面,实现功能交互。现在一些对前端代码敏感的网站会混淆和加密JS,但效果不是太大。那些想复制代码来实现逻辑的人可以解决它
而客户端程序一般来说,它是编译后的可执行文件,不需要源代码。不过,经过一些反编译软件反编译后,你大概可以看到程序的实现逻辑
HTML不能被加密!因为浏览器不支持加密!互联网上有很多所谓的加密,其实网页是通过Unicode代码的转换来实现的。这些加密可以通过转换简单的Unicode代码来解密,这是没有用的。而这些加密意味着只有当你右击查看源代码时,你才会看到加密信息。如果是浏览器的F12调试页面,则直接显示解密页面。而过多的中文文本会导致你的加密页面代码膨胀。英语可以压缩。
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。